Thinking Outside of the Box
Key learning and description of session
Although creative thinking and imagination are critical to an organization’s continued growth and profitability, it is often our human nature to behave in ways that do not favor thinking creatively and using imagination is often frowned upon in organizational context. In this session we will explore how leaders and their team members can tap into their intrinsic motivation and make space for reflective imaginative thinking. In order for creative ideas to flourish, a context must be provided where creativity is continually sought, valued and where environments and creativity are exciting and dynamic. Moving beyond traditional brainstorming, we will introduce effective, yet simple techniques to assist the creative thinking process including methods that build in lateral, divergent thinking.

Performance Management Minimizing Stress, Maximizing Effectiveness
Key learning and description of session
If you’re like most managers, performance management is stressful. Today’s business climate adds a new layer of uncertainty and accountability, making performance management even tougher to navigate. This seminar gives you the time-tested roadmap for developing and reviewing performance that aligns with rapidly changing priorities and organizational goals to help you stay focused and move your team forward.
